Subscribe NowNEW DELHI: The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) will close the registration window for the recruitment of various Junior Engineer (JE) vacancies 2024 today, April 18. Interested candidates who meet the eligibility prerequisites can fill out the SSC JE application form 2024 by visiting the official website, ssc.gov.in.
The objective of the SSC recruitment drive is to fill 968 positions for Junior Engineers across civil, mechanical, and electrical domains. Of total, 338 positions are designated for the Central Public Works Department and 475 for the Border Road Organisation.
Candidates will have to pay the SSC JE application fee 2024 to successfully register for the exam. Candidates will be able to pay the SSC JE application fee till April 18. The SSC JE exam 2024 will be conducted from June 4 to 6 at multiple test centres across the country.
SSC JE 2024: Paper 1 pattern
Candidates appearing for SSC JE paper 1 can check the exam pattern in the table given below-
| Sections | Total questions | Total marks |
|---|---|---|
| General Intelligence & Reasoning | 50 | 50 |
| General Awareness | 50 | 50 |
| General Engineering (Civil & Structural or Electrical or Mechanical) | 100 | 100 |
| Total | 200 | 200 |
Candidates will be awarded one mark is awarded for each correct answer in the paper. There is a negative marking of 0.25 marks for every incorrect answer. While no marks will be deducted for questions left unanswered.
SSC JE application 2024 correction window
After the registration deadline, the commission will initiate the SSC JE application correction window on April 22. Those who have completed their exam registration will have the opportunity to modify their application details through this facility. The deadline for editing the SSC JE application form is April 24, 2024. Candidates will need to access the correction portal using their login credentials, including their registration number and date of birth.
